If you’ve never had amaranth, today is the day I introduce you to one of my favorite whole grains in the world.

A staple food of the ancient Aztecs, amaranth is gluten-free food and a source of complete protein. It contains all the essential amino acids, including lysine, which is lacking in most grains. My source of a bag of these tiny jewels is Bob’s Red Mill. Mind you, this isn’t a sponsored post. Cheesy Amaranth Breakfast Bowl
Prep Time:10 minutes
Cook Time:5 minutes
Total Time:15 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 cup amaranth cooked
  • ½ cup light cream
  • ¼ cup shredded sharp cheddar
  • salt and pepper to taste

for the bowl:

  • ½ avocado sliced
  • handful fresh kale chopped
  • 1 large egg

Instructions

  • Over medium heat, whisk together the amaranth, cream, and cheddar until it becomes a smooth mixture. Season with salt and pepper, while simmering for about 5 minutes until amaranth thickens.
  • In saute pan with a drizzle of coconut oil, sauté the kale until tender. Remove kale and in the same pan add extra coconut oil and fry your egg until crispy on the edges.
  • To prepare the bowl, spoon cheese amaranth into a bowl and top with slice avocado, fried egg, and sautéed kale. Serve immediately.
Servings: 1 breakfast bowl
